BCHM 4034 (VMS 4034) (BMVS 4034) - Environmental Health Toxicology
Health effects associated with the exposure to chemicals, identifying and managing problems of chemical exposure in work places and the environment, fundamental principles of biopharmaceutics and toxicokinetics, and risk assessment. Emphasis on conceptual understanding of chemical entry into the body, biotransformation, multiple chemical sensitivity, and chemically induced diseases. Identification of nutrient interactions with environmentally induced disorders and to understand the mechanisms of such interactions and their influence on human health and welfare.

BCHM 4054 (APSC 4054) - Genomics
A contemporary analysis of the development, utility and application of high-resolution methods for the study and manipulation of the complete genomes of organisms. The use of new techniques for genomic, metabolic and protein engineering (functional genomics), including high-throughput methods and nanotechnology, will be emphasized. II

BCHM 4224 - Spectroscopy of Biomolecules
Presentation of the applications of modern spectroscopic methods, including UV-visible, fluorescence, NMR, ESR, CD/ORD, and mass spectrometry, to biochemical analysis. Selected instruments and their uses will be demonstrated. II

BCHM 5204 - Molecular Biology of Eucaryotic Gene Expression
Mechanisms controlling eucaryotic gene expression. Topics include biochemistry and metabolism of DNA and RNA, gene and chromatin structure, enzymology of replication and transcription, modification and processing of RNA, recombinant DNA and molecular cloning techniques. I

BCHM 5304 - Enzyme Kinetics and Reaction Mechanisms
Analysis of the mechanisms of enzyme-catalyzed reactions using kinetic and spectroscopic measurements, inhibitors and other chemical probes, or enzyme modification via site-directed mutagenesis. Development and interpretation of kinetic rate equations. Theory and models of enzymatic catalysis. II. Alternate years.

BCHM 5444 - Molecular Modeling of Proteins and Nucleic Acids
Theory and practice of molecular modeling as applied to biological macromolecules. Topics include molecular mechanics, molecular dynamics, homology modeling, protein- ligand interactions, and rational drug design. II

BCHM 5454 - Biochemistry and Molecular Biology of Anaerobic Organisms
Contemporary analysis of the biochemistry, genetics, and ecology of strictly anaerobic organisms with emphasis on metabolism as it influences ecological niche and elicits the beneficial and deleterious effects on mankind; techniques to achieve anaerobiosis; role of anaerobic organisms in disease and industrial processes; genome structure of selected anaerobes.
